  1. Job Summary


The Server is responsible for supporting the seamless running of the restaurant by providing a highly efficient and effective service, ensuring standards are maintained and customer needs are anticipated. Establishing and maintaining good working relationships amongst the restaurant and the kitchen team. 

 

II. Essential Job Functions

 

Job Activities


Customer Service

  • Provides a speedy, efficient and professional level of service at all times.
  • Is responsive to any guest’s request. 
  • Controls section during service, taking orders and issuing bills.
  • Ensures that all customers receive the best possible service and care. 
  • Maximizes sales opportunities through good service and table scanning.
  • Makes side dishes or appetizers tableside for any customer.
  • Runs drinks from the service bar if needed to the customer. 
  • Cuts any meat tableside if needed.
  • Makes meat tartar or tuna tartar tableside if needed.
  • Runs food to any table as needed. 
  • Works with restaurant staff to create a positive dining experience for guests.
  • Greets customers and answers any and all questions.
  • Alerts team members when tables are in need of attention, if they are not present assists them in helping with their tables.
  • Has knowledge of the menu, with the ability to make suggestions.
  • Ensures tables are enjoying their meals and takes action to correct any problems.
  • Collects payments from tables.

IV. Education, Experience and Skill Requirements

  • High School Diploma
  • Good communication and organizational skills.
  • Ability to handle stressful situations and be able to prevent and/or handle emergency situations.
  • A cheerful, positive attitude when working with a variety of people, and be able to work well under pressure.
  • Responsible, neat and clean in appearance.
  • Strong communication skills with supervisors and team members.
  • Must be able to read, write and speak English.
